儋州市网站建设_网站建设公司_导航菜单_seo优化
2025/12/31 8:00:12 网站建设 项目流程

RetroArch界面显示异常?5种快速修复资源加载问题的终极方案

【免费下载链接】RetroArchCross-platform, sophisticated frontend for the libretro API. Licensed GPLv3.项目地址: https://gitcode.com/GitHub_Trending/re/RetroArch

你是否遇到过RetroArch启动后界面图标消失、背景黑屏或字体显示乱码的情况?这些RetroArch资源加载异常问题困扰着许多用户,特别是新手玩家。本文将为你提供一套完整的解决方案,从问题识别到彻底修复,让你轻松应对各种界面显示异常。

🚨 常见问题表现:识别你的RetroArch症状

当RetroArch界面资源加载出现问题时,通常会表现为以下几种情况:

  • 图标完全消失:主菜单中的游戏、设置、退出等按钮变成空白方块
  • 背景纯黑:漂亮的主题背景被黑色覆盖
  • 字体显示异常:文字重叠、大小不一或完全无法显示
  • 主题切换无效:更换不同主题后界面没有任何变化

图:RetroArch界面资源加载异常时的Ozone主题界面

🔍 问题根源解析:为什么资源会加载失败?

RetroArch的资源文件(包括主题图片、字体和音效)存储在特定的assets目录中。当程序无法正确找到这些文件时,就会出现界面显示异常。主要原因包括:

  • 配置文件路径错误:retroarch.cfg中的assets_directory设置不正确
  • 文件权限不足:资源文件没有读取权限
  • 目录结构不完整:缺少必要的子文件夹或文件
  • 版本不匹配:资源文件与RetroArch核心版本不兼容

💡 5种终极修复方案:从简单到全面

方案一:检查并修复配置文件路径

这是最常见也最容易解决的问题。打开你的retroarch.cfg文件,找到以下关键设置:

# 确保路径指向正确的assets目录 assets_directory = "/完整路径/RetroArch/assets" menu_driver = "xmb" # 或"ozone"、"rgui"

操作步骤

  1. 进入Settings > Directory
  2. 检查Assets Directory的设置
  3. 如果路径错误,手动修改为正确的目录位置

方案二:使用在线更新器自动修复

RetroArch内置了强大的在线更新功能,可以自动下载和修复资源文件:

  1. 主菜单 > 在线更新器 > 更新Assets
  2. 等待下载完成
  3. 重启RetroArch

方案三:手动重新部署资源文件

如果自动更新无效,可以手动重新部署资源:

  1. 删除现有的assets目录
  2. 从官方仓库重新获取:git clone https://gitcode.com/GitHub_Trending/re/RetroArch.git
  3. 确保目录结构完整:
assets/ ├── xmb/ ├── ozone/ ├── rgui/ └── sounds/

方案四:启用便携模式避免路径冲突

在RetroArch根目录创建portable.txt文件,强制程序使用相对路径而非系统路径:

# 在RetroArch安装目录执行 touch portable.txt

方案五:完整重置与重新安装

作为最后的手段,可以完全重置RetroArch:

  1. 备份重要存档和配置
  2. 删除整个RetroArch目录
  3. 重新下载最新版本并安装

📊 修复方案优先级对照表

问题严重程度推荐方案预计耗时成功率
轻度(部分图标缺失)方案一 + 方案二5-10分钟95%
中度(主题无法加载)方案三15-20分钟85%
重度(界面完全异常)方案四 + 方案五30分钟以上99%

🛡️ 预防措施与最佳实践

为了避免未来再次遇到RetroArch资源加载问题,建议遵循以下最佳实践:

定期维护习惯

  • 每月检查更新:通过在线更新器保持资源文件最新
  • 备份配置:定期保存当前的配置文件
  • 统一安装路径:避免在不同位置安装多个RetroArch版本

配置优化建议

  • 使用相对路径:在配置文件中尽量使用相对路径
  • 避免手动修改:除非必要,不要直接编辑配置文件
  • 保持版本同步:确保核心、资源和前端的版本匹配

图:RetroArch资源正常加载时的XMB主题界面

🎯 总结与后续建议

通过以上5种方案,绝大多数RetroArch界面资源加载异常问题都能得到解决。关键是要按照优先级顺序尝试,从最简单的配置检查开始。

如果你的问题仍未解决

  1. 尝试切换到不同的菜单驱动(XMB/Ozone/RGUI)
  2. 查看日志文件定位具体错误
  3. 在官方社区寻求帮助并提供详细的问题描述

记住,保持RetroArch及其资源的及时更新是预防这类问题的最佳方法。现在就开始行动,让你的RetroArch界面恢复正常显示吧!✨

【免费下载链接】RetroArchCross-platform, sophisticated frontend for the libretro API. Licensed GPLv3.项目地址: https://gitcode.com/GitHub_Trending/re/RetroArch

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询